Transaction d71ab6fbdf7cf319f5869563d46106e98046ff5c11606fca8d9dcc98ee41d239

1 Input
2 Outputs
  • d71ab6fbdf7cf319f5869563d46106e98046ff5c11606fca8d9dcc98ee41d239:0
  • value  50000000
    address  mutRwL96oBCst3aNqBSjWrUmEWrmCPXKZZ
  • d71ab6fbdf7cf319f5869563d46106e98046ff5c11606fca8d9dcc98ee41d239:1
  • value  64934456809
    address  2NAK6d965hsCSdPsUHESRVdCxzzPDeJjj6Y